10 Mindfulness Techniques to Enhance Your Inner Peace
In today's fast-paced world, finding moments of tranquility can be challenging. Mindfulness techniques offer practical ways to enhance your inner peace and cultivate a sense of calm. Here are 10 mindfulness techniques that can help you reconnect with your inner self:
- Breathe Deeply: Focus on your breath, inhaling deeply through your nose and exhaling slowly through your mouth. This technique helps anchor your thoughts and calm your mind.
- Body Scan: Lie quietly and mentally scan your body from head to toe, paying attention to any areas of tension and consciously relaxing them.
- Mindful Walking: Take a walk and notice each step, the sensation of your feet touching the ground, and the sights and sounds around you.
- Gratitude Journaling: Write down three things you are grateful for every day to shift your focus away from stress and negativity.
- Guided Meditation: Use apps or videos to follow structured meditations designed to enhance mindfulness.
- Sensory Awareness: Spend time focusing on one of your senses. For example, savor the taste of your food, listen to ambient sounds, or appreciate the textures around you.
- Mindfulness Coloring: Engage in adult coloring books to relax your mind and focus on the present moment.
- Nature Connection: Spend time in nature and immerse yourself in its beauty, allowing your mind to clear.
- Mindful Listening: Practice listening attentively when someone speaks, focusing entirely on their words rather than formulating your response.
- Awareness of Thoughts: Observe your thoughts without judgment. Recognize them and let them pass without getting emotionally involved.

How to Create a Peaceful Environment at Home: Tips and Tricks
Creating a peaceful environment at home can significantly enhance your well-being and productivity. Start by decluttering your space; a tidy home can lead to a tidy mind. Consider implementing a regular cleaning schedule, focusing on areas that often accumulate mess, such as living areas, kitchens, and bedrooms. Additionally, choose calming colors for your walls and decor, such as soft blues and greens, which can promote a sense of tranquility.
Another essential aspect of achieving a serene atmosphere is incorporating natural elements. Add plants to your home; they not only purify the air but also bring a sense of nature indoors. Utilize soft lighting, such as table lamps or string lights, to create a warm ambiance. To finalize your peaceful sanctuary, consider implementing sounds of nature, like soft rain or ocean waves, by using apps or playing gentle music. These small adjustments can transform your house into a haven of peace.
What Are Effective Boundaries for Protecting Your Mental Health?
Establishing effective boundaries is crucial for protecting your mental health in today’s fast-paced world. These boundaries help to define what is acceptable and what is not, allowing you to create a safe space for yourself. For instance, you might implement time boundaries by setting specific work hours to prevent burnout or establishing emotional boundaries that protect you from absorbing others' negativity. Consider journaling your feelings or practicing mindfulness as ways to reinforce these boundaries and prioritize your mental well-being.
In addition to personal boundaries, effective communication is essential when it comes to maintaining them. Be assertive about your needs, whether it's saying no to social invitations or expressing your limits to family and friends. Remember, it is important to regularly reassess your boundaries as your life circumstances change. Keep in mind that healthy boundaries foster not only your mental health but also improve your relationships, leading to a more balanced and fulfilling life. Consider seeking support from a mental health professional if you're struggling to set these boundaries effectively.
